Attock Petroleum Limited (APL) has unveiled its new brand, Attock LPG, marking a significant step towards providing cleaner energy solutions in Pakistan.

Liquefied Petroleum Gas (LPG) is a crucial energy source in Pakistan, widely used in households, industries, and transportation.

As the country grapples with energy shortages and environmental concerns, the demand for cleaner and efficient fuel sources has risen. The LPG sector has witnessed growth due to its affordability and lower carbon emissions compared to traditional fossil fuels.

Key players in Pakistan’s LPG market include companies like Sui Southern Gas Company (SSGC), Sui Northern Gas Pipelines Limited (SNGPL), and Pakistan State Oil (PSO), alongside emerging entities and local distributors.

These companies have contributed to the expansion of the LPG infrastructure, making it more accessible to consumers across the nation.

The launch event took place at the company’s headquarters and emphasized APL’s commitment to environmentally friendly fuel alternatives.

With the slogan “Together, We Deliver Energy,” APL is seeking potential distributors to join its network. The company invites applications from established entrepreneurs and financial investors interested in the growing liquefied petroleum gas (LPG) market.

Potential distributors will need to comply with APL’s regulatory guidelines, ensuring quality and reliability in service. The company aims to meet diverse energy needs, including household use, industrial requirements, and transportation energy.

Attock Petroleum Limited’s new venture into the LPG sector aims to contribute to a sustainable energy future in Pakistan, offering a responsible alternative in the petroleum industry.
